Here are 3 tips to maximize heal usage for daeodons:
1: If a daeodon runs out of food, don't force feed it until it's back at full. Instead, leave render distance then go back, and the daeodon will be fully fed so long as it had enough food.
2: Cook any meat with an Industrial Grill before feeding it to a daeodon. Cooked meat give more food, so you won't waste as much meat if it's cooked before eaten.
3: Most medium to large water creatures, such as Manta, Ichthyo, and Megalodon, give rediculous amounts of meat compared to other creatures, use this to your advantage when looking for food for your Daeodon.

A Yutyrannus is by far one of the best ways to deal with these guys. You can easily scare these guys away from you. It also seems that when they are scared they can't activate their heal ability which makes it easier to pick them off. Another good method is to use a shotgun. It deals huge enough bursts of damage that they can be close to death in a few shots, good for if they show up unexpectedly while you're on your own.

They appear in packs of three around the entire snow biomie.
Find an isolated pack away from wolfs, Carnos or Yutyrannus and pick the, of with a powerful gun, note that they don’t heal when at a decent range from the player, once they are about two strides from you they will start to heal themselves.
Provided with a crap ton of food, daeodons can be easy to tame because of the food drain. Also you don't have to worry too much about killing them while knocking them out as they use their food stat to heal.
These things are super useful if you want a wyvern but don’t want to do the whole process of getting a wyvern, you turn on passive healing and when the baby wyvern hatches you don’t have to give it wyvern milk but just let the daedon keep healing the baby. Super useful and easy
